Nissan plans to offer 15 hybrid vehicles by 2016

Currently, the only fully ecological model sold by the Japanese manufacturer in North America, it is entirely electric LEAF.

However, Nissan announced the release of 2016 15 hybrid vehicles.

A new approach is part of the Nissan Green Project 2016.

The manufacturer speaks, among other things, a technology of its own, which includes a four-cylinder engine combines a 2.5-liter electric motor fed by a lithium-ion battery.

Although Nissan did not mention any specific model, one can easily imagine that the Altima and Maxima ranges should be the first to enjoy this new hybrid technology.

Recall that the division upscale Infiniti Nissan vehicles, already offers its M luxury sedan driven by a hybrid powertrain.
